  The Headlines:

  In the role ofCategory Manager- CAPEX(capital expenditures), you will be a lead in the North America CAPEX Procurement team, which supports Supply Chain. The CAPEX Procurement team supports an annual spend of $500 - $700M per year. This role will lead the procurement efforts for $100M - $150M annually. You will be responsible for supporting the team of Corporate Engineers as they develop and execute strategic projects (+$50M) across our North American breweries and support factilities. You will play a key role in supplier relationship management, to help find, select, and monitor the performance of our key suppliers. Categories in scope for you include warehouse automation, plant recapitalization projects, greenfield site development, and site transformations. Travel (20%-25%) to project sites is expected, with occassional international trips to support project needs.

  The ideal candidate for this role is self motivated, passionate about teamwork, a relationship builder, and a creative problem solver. This role requires a high level of expertise in negotiating contract terms with external vendors, strategic sourcing principles, the procure-to-pay process, and has the ability to partner closely with internal stakeholders including Legal, Risk, Engineering, and Finance to meet the complex needs of the business. You should expect to interact with both internal and external Executives during the supplier relationship process. Ideally this candidate will have 7+ years of procurement and contracting experience.

  This position in based in Milwaukee, WI. You will report to the Sr Category Manager, North America CAPEX Procurement, and work closely with cross functional teams in Milwaukee, Canada, and the Brewery teams.

  The Responsibilities:

  Lead transformative projects, drive simplification, and best in class ways of working within your categories.

  Maintain supplier relationships, lead negotiations, conduct sourcing events, and conduct Top to Top leadership meetings.

  Identify and deliver cost savings, cost avoidance and other measures of financial value (target $10M-$15M annually)

  Deliver annual and long-range business planning, development, and delivery of category strategies.

  The Other Qualifications:

  7 or more years of relevant experience in procurement

  Expert in category strategy, strategic sourcing, supplier management, and spend analysis.

  Demonstrated construction and capital equipmentcontract knowledge and negotiation skills.

  Experience in beverage or high-speed consumer goods in a multi-national environment preferred.

  Bachelor’s Degree in related field
